I'm asking because there are certain economic advantages to go with the +R but I don't have a clear picture of the pros and cons. Many DVD burners have "bitsetting" capability. With such burners, DVD+R can be set to DVD-ROM "book type", that is, players think the disc is DVD-ROM. Mike Richter, the slimiest friggin SOB, calls the bitsetting operation as "quirky", "anomalous" or "trickier" as if you have to burn it with a cigarette lighter, a magnifying glass and a needle. (Nero does it automatically by default.) DVD+R vs. DVD-R
J. Yazel wrote:
Is DVD+R better than DVD-R and if not why not? I'm asking because there are certain economic advantages to go with the +R but I don't have a clear picture of the pros and cons. Thanks for any help . Jack While most modern drives will read +R and -R equally well, I've found that European systems are more likely to be happy with +R, American ones with -R. (I have too few data from other areas to generalize.) For most purposes, they are equivalent but it may be relevant that most true premium media on the market are -R. DVD+R vs. DVD-R
Drew wrote:
Is all the information about -R carry over for -RW? The only carryover is that +RW and -RW are functionally equivalent for most users. Neither is to be trusted for extended storage. They have proved so far to be as unreliable if not quite as fragile as CD-RW. Mike -- http://www.mrichter.com/ |
